Why Integrate Google calendar and Streak?

Google Calendar and Streak are two powerful tools that can enhance productivity and streamline workflows, especially for individuals and teams managing customer relationships and schedules. Integrating these applications can help users combine scheduling with customer relationship management seamlessly.

With Google Calendar, users can keep track of appointments, deadlines, and events. It offers features like reminders, color-coded calendars, and event sharing, making it easy to manage personal and professional commitments.

Streak, on the other hand, is built right into Gmail and allows users to manage their sales processes, support tickets, and other customer interactions directly from their inbox. It’s a CRM tool that provides features like pipeline management, email tracking, and task assignments directly associated with email threads.

By integrating Google Calendar with Streak, users can:

  1. Synchronize Events: Automatically sync calendar events with Streak to ensure that all team members are aware of important meetings and deadlines.
  2. Track Customer Engagement: Log interactions that occur during scheduled meetings and link them directly to Streak profiles, providing a comprehensive view of customer engagement.
  3. Set Reminders: Create reminders for follow-up tasks based on calendar events that are co-related with customer interactions.
  4. Manage Time Effectively: Use Google Calendar to allocate time blocks for tasks related to different deals in Streak, improving focus and productivity.

How Does Streak work?

Streak is a powerful tool designed to enhance productivity by integrating directly with your Gmail interface, allowing users to manage customer relationships, sales processes, and projects seamlessly. The beauty of Streak lies in its ability to customize workflows and automate tasks, making it an invaluable asset for businesses of all sizes. It operates using a flexible system of pipelines and boxes that can be tailored to specific needs, enabling users to keep track of their interactions effectively.

Can I automate reminders from Streak to Google Calendar?

Yes, you can automate reminders from Streak to Google Calendar. By setting up an integration that triggers a new Google Calendar event when a specific condition is met in Streak (like a status change or a due date), you can ensure that important tasks and reminders are reflected in your calendar automatically.
